    Charlie "Jersey" Earl Zane Jr., left us April 16, 2017, 10 days before his 80th birthday. He was the only child of Charles Sr. and Myrtis (Simpson) Zane. He was a Jersey boy, born in Camden, New Jersey (N.J.), April 26th, 1937.
    Charlie was on his way to California when he ran out of money in Rochester, Minn. He worked for IBM and spent two years in the Army. The day he came back to Rochester, he met a friend and asked, "where are you going?" "To Winona State to play football." "Heck, I played football and baseball in the Army, I'll go with you." "Where and you going?" were four words that changed his life. It lead to his education, sports (playing, coaching and refereeing), a career, and many lifelong friendships.
    He is survived by his wife, Marlys (Pater) Zane; son, Cameron (Jayne) Zane; and daughter, Stacey (Tony) Greene and their two children, Tyler and Garrett, his precious grandchildren.
    Charlie donated his body to Mayo Clinic for research.
